My strangest bird sighting of 2008: Last night, as we returned to the in-laws' house in Cashmere at about 9:00 PM, a LINCOLN'S SPARROW flushed from the honeysuckle thicket at the corner of the carport. It flew out along the Christmas lights under the soffit and then back into the thicket. I am assuming that it was taking advantage of the several degree difference in temperature provided by the lights (the thermometer read 16 degr. F).

The strange part is that it was a Lincoln's, which I am usually hard pressed to find here even in the spring or summer.
